What was Lincoln's constitutional justification for issuing the Emancipation Proclamation?
Yuri [45]

Answer:

Lincoln justified emancipation as a wartime measure, and was careful to apply it only to the Confederate states currently in rebellion. Exempt from the proclamation were the four border slave states and all or parts of three Confederate states controlled by the Union Arm

Help asap<br><br> How did Manifest Destiny play a role in the removal of the Cherokee?
I am Lyosha [343]

Manifest Destiny played a role in the removal of the Cherokee because people believed it was the United States God given right to expand. This meant the Cherokee needed to leave in order for them to expand their borders westward.
